The Top 12 became a Top 11 when Lacey Brown was voted off of American Idol last week, and though she's not going to be on the show anymore, she has a surprisingly upbeat attitude about it. I listened in on a post-elimination media call with her last week, and got to hear all about what being voted off feels like, why she chose the songs she did and what Simon says to eliminated contestants before they ship off. Read on for highlights.
Do you think you can pinpoint what your downfall was?
Lacey Brown: You know, I would probably have to say energy. I think they kept asking for energy in my songs, and I kept trying to give it, and they kept trying to say, you know, it was a sleepy performance. The issue that I was having is, I really love to sing ballads. I love telling a story with a song. I love the emotion of the song. I'm very artsy, so that side of me comes out when I sing.
And so I think I kept picking songs that I really loved to sing and really felt, and maybe it didn't transfer as well stage wise. Even though I'm a bubbly happy person, not every song that I sing is going to be up-tempo. If I could say anything, I would say possibly that. I'm not really sure, but even if it is, I wouldn't have changed a thing.
Why did you choose "Ruby Tuesday"?
LB: You know, I honestly looked. We had a very limited list. But I love that song. I think it's a great thing for a girl like me to be signing on a big stage like that. It has a great message, and I connected with that song, so that's why I picked it. And even after the 50/50 remarks that I was getting on how they weren't really sure what they liked about it. They liked this, but they didn't like this about it, and they were 50/50 on it. I loved doing it. And I loved the arrangement, and some people, I mean, a lot of my fans were really digging it too.
Were you shocked or angry to be eliminated, or did you see it coming?
LB: There's two different approaches that you can take to being voted off. You can be happy with the situation and make the most of it, which is the route I'm trying to take. I haven't put my focus on anything negative going on. This is a reality show, and this is a show that someone has to go home every week, and the fan base is very, very, very important. And I think it has been a shocker sometimes, but that's just the nature, you know, of the beast that is American Idol. It's how the show rolls. So, no, I think someone has got to go home every week, and if it's you, then it's you, and it's out of your hands at that moment.
Simon went right up to you at the end of the show, and you were a little bit emotional. What did he say? Did he say anything nice to you?
LB: Yes. All the judges came up afterward. I think they genuinely care about the contestants. Sometimes it's hard to hear their critiques, but they're there to help you, and it's a fine line between taking what they say personally and taking what they say and applying it to yourself to fix yourself, and work things out that you need to work out.
